Output 33d89e9dcac99bf834ae4e6374c21faa7b1c4ed1f098aab0ea57b7145d40e079:26

value
22798
script pubkey
OP_0 OP_PUSHBYTES_20 8092109fa7e02736101a25a5badadd4ac8769bef
address
bc1qszfpp8a8uqnnvyq6ykjm4kkafty8dxl0wgv0l2
transaction
33d89e9dcac99bf834ae4e6374c21faa7b1c4ed1f098aab0ea57b7145d40e079
spent
false